Shale Shaker
Shale shakers are an essential piece of equipment in the drilling industry. They are used to separate solids from drilling fluid and offer many benefits, including better well and drilling fluid management. Shaker screens are a crucial component of shale shakers as they are responsible for removing the cuttings and other debris from the drilling fluid. Vacuum Degasser
A vacuum degasser is a type of industrial equipment that helps to remove gases from liquids, typically used in the oil and gas industry. It is a critical part of many drilling operations, as it helps to prevent issues such as corrosion, foaming, and other potential hazards associated with high-pressure drilling environments. The basic principle of a vacuum degasser is to create a low-pressure zone within the liquid, which helps the gas bubbles to rise up and escape. This is accomplished through a variety of mechanisms, such as spinning disks, cones, or other types of rotors. Vacuum degassers come in a wide range of sizes and capacities, from small units suitable for laboratory use to large-scale systems used in commercial drilling operations. Regardless of their size, vacuum degassers play a vital role in ensuring the efficient and safe operation of industrial processes.
Mud Cleaner
Mud cleaner is a piece of equipment used in oil and gas drilling operations to remove solids (such as sand, silt, and sediment) from drilling fluids. This equipment is also known as a desander or desilter, depending on its specific function. The mud cleaner uses a combination of hydrocyclones and screens to separate the solids from the drilling fluid, which is then returned to the mud tank for reuse. This process helps to maintain the viscosity and density of the drilling fluid, which is important for efficient drilling operations. The mud cleaner is an essential component of the drilling process, as the buildup of solids can lead to drilling delays, equipment damage, and safety hazards. Therefore, it is important to ensure that the mud cleaner is operated and maintained properly to prevent any issues during drilling operations.

Vertical Cutting Dryer
The vertical cutting dryer is a highly efficient equipment utilized in the oil and gas industry for the separation of drilling solids from drilling fluids. It is a state-of-the-art technology that employs centrifugal force generated by a sturdy basket equipped with uniquely designed cutting edges. As the basket rotates at high speed, it extracts moisture and oils from the drilled solids, leaving the drilling fluids clean and reusable. This system is an effective alternative to traditional manual methods of solids control, and reduces the environmental impact of drilling operations by minimizing waste disposal and reducing the consumption of fresh drilling fluids. Its efficient design and high capacity help operators to optimize drilling performance, maintain drilling fluid properties, and enhance the quality of the final product. The vertical cutting dryer offers numerous benefits to the industry, including lower costs, increased productivity, and enhanced environmental compliance.

Mud Agitator
A mud agitator is an important piece of equipment used in the drilling industry to mix drilling fluid, also known as mud. The mud agitator is designed to keep the drilling fluid in suspension, preventing it from settling and ensuring a consistent mixture. This is important to prevent blockages in the drilling system and to overcome the resistance of the formation being drilled.
Jet Mud Mixer
The jet mud mixer is an advanced piece of equipment that is widely used in the oil and gas drilling industry. It is designed to mix drilling fluids (also known as drilling mud) that are critical to the drilling process. The jet mud mixer works by using high-pressure jets to force drilling fluid into a mixing chamber, where it is combined with other additives to create a balanced mud that is able to perform a variety of functions. These functions include lubricating the drill bit, keeping the drill hole stable, and carrying rock cuttings to the surface.
